The product of multiplying an integer by itself is the square of a number. Square is used in programming, calculating areas, and so on. In the topic, we will discuss the square of 932.
The square of a number is the product of the number itself. The square of 932 is 932 × 932. The square of a number always ends in 0, 1, 4, 5, 6, or 9. We write it in math as 932², where 932 is the base and 2 is the exponent. The square of a positive and a negative number is always positive. For example, 5² = 25; (-5)² = 25.
The square of 932 is 932 × 932 = 868,624.
Square of 932 in exponential form: 932²
Square of 932 in arithmetic form: 932 × 932
The square of a number is multiplying the number by itself. So let’s learn how to find the square of a number. These are the common methods used to find the square of a number.
In this method, we will multiply the number by itself to find the square. The product here is the square of the number. Let’s find the square of 932:
Step 1: Identify the number. Here, the number is 932
Step 2: Multiplying the number by itself, we get, 932 × 932 = 868,624.
The square of 932 is 868,624.

Find the length of the square, where the area of the square is 868,624 cm².
The area of a square = a²
So, the area of a square = 868,624 cm²
So, the length = √868,624 = 932.
The length of each side = 932 cm
The length of a square is 932 cm.
Because the area is 868,624 cm², the length is √868,624 = 932.
Tom is planning to paint his square wall of length 932 feet. The cost to paint a foot is 3 dollars. Then how much will it cost to paint the full wall?
The length of the wall = 932 feet
The cost to paint 1 square foot of the wall = 3 dollars.
To find the total cost to paint, we find the area of the wall,
Area of the wall = area of the square = a²
Here a = 932
Therefore, the area of the wall = 932² = 932 × 932 = 868,624.
The cost to paint the wall = 868,624 × 3 = 2,605,872.
The total cost = 2,605,872 dollars
To find the cost to paint the wall, we multiply the area of the wall by the cost to paint per foot. So, the total cost is 2,605,872 dollars.
